CIRCUIT DESCRIPTION
The inflatable restraint Sensing and Diagnostic Module (SDM) monitors the front end discriminating sensor circuit for front impact detection. The SDM processes the signal provided by the front end discriminating sensor to further support deployment of the air bags. The front end discriminating sensor is an input only to the SDM and does not directly cause air bag deployment. When you first turn the ignition ON, the inflatable restraint sensing and diagnostic module (SDM) performs tests to diagnose critical malfunctions within itself. The SDM then performs the following continuous diagnostic tests on the deployment loops:
^ Deployment loop voltage out of range test
^ Deployment loop resistance measurement test
If the voltage out of range tests detects a short to voltage condition, the resistance measurement test for that deployment loop will not be performed.
CONDITIONS FOR RUNNING THE DTC
^ Ignition 1 is within the normal operating voltage range.
^ The SDM monitors the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or loop with the ignition ON.
CONDITIONS FOR SETTING THE DTC
The voltage at the discriminating sensor signal input is 0.5 volts or less for 300 milliseconds.
ACTION TAKEN WHEN THE DTC SETS
^ The SDM disables the discriminating sensor input.
^ The SDM commands ON the AIR BAG warning lamp via Class 2 serial data.
CONDITIONS FOR CLEARING THE DTC
^ The voltage at the discriminating sensor signal input is greater than 0.5 volts for 300 milliseconds.
^ You issue a scan tool CLEAR CODES command.
^ A history DTC will clear once 255 malfunction free ignition cycles have occurred.
DIAGNOSTIC AIDS
A short to ground condition in the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or loop can cause an intermittent condition. Inspect the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or circuits carefully for cutting or chafing. Refer to Testing for Intermittent and Poor Connections in Diagrams.
TEST DESCRIPTION
The numbers below refer to the step numbers on the diagnostic table:
2. This step checks the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or wiring harness connector.
4. This step checks the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or.
6. This step checks the inflatable restraint sensing and diagnostic module (SDM) wiring harness connector.
8. This step checks for a short to ground in the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or input circuit.
10. This step checks for a short to ground in the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or return circuit.
12. This step determines if there is a short to between the inflatable restraint front end discriminating sensor input and return circuits or if there is a malfunctioning SDM.
